Vacations for Boutique Skincare Packaging Design

When you are designing packaging for beauty or wellness products, the typography needs to sit comfortably alongside imagery without competing for attention. Vacations excels in this specific niche because its letterforms have a natural rhythm that mimics hand-lettering but retains the precision required for professional print production. I tested this font on a mockup for a face serum label, placing it across the center of a minimalist white bottle. The contrast between the clean background and the fluid strokes of the script font created an immediate sense of quality.

The ligatures included in this typeface family are particularly useful here. Instead of manually adjusting kerning pairs to fix awkward gaps between letters like 'a' and 'v', the built-in ligatures handle the transitions smoothly. This allows designers to maintain visual hierarchy while ensuring the product name remains the focal point. For handmade sellers and online shop owners looking to elevate their product labels, using a font with these stylish alternates can significantly boost perceived value without needing complex graphic design skills.

Vacations in Wedding Invitations and Event Branding

Wedding stationery is one of those industries where "chic" and "readable" often feel like opposing forces. Many couples want a romantic, flowing aesthetic but also need their guests to actually be able to read the date and venue details. Vacations strikes a delicate balance between decorative flair and legibility. I recently used this font for a digital invitation suite for a creative studio’s team retreat, and the results were striking.

Because it is a handwritten font with a refined structure, it works beautifully as a display font for headers and names. However, it is crucial to use it correctly. I paired Vacations with a simple, clean sans serif font for the logistical details (time, location, RSVP info). This combination leverages the strengths of both typefaces: the emotional appeal of the script for the main title and the functional clarity of the sans serif for body text. When designing social media graphics for event promotions, this pairing ensures that your message is engaging yet easy to scan quickly on mobile devices.

Vacations for Logo Design and Identity Systems

Can a script font work for a logo? Absolutely, provided it has enough character and versatility. Vacations is not just a decorative element; it has the structural integrity to serve as a primary logo mark for brands that want to convey creativity and personal touch. Whether you are branding a local restaurant, a bakery, or a freelance portfolio, this font adds an instant layer of personality.

In my testing, I found that the font performs best when used for short phrases or single-word logos. Attempting to use it for long company names can compromise readability, especially when scaled down for favicons or business card corners. The stylish alternates allow you to customize the look slightly depending on the context—for instance, using a more elaborate alternate for the first letter of a brand name to create a distinctive monogram effect. This adaptability makes it a valuable asset in a designer’s toolkit for creating cohesive brand identities that stand out in crowded markets.

Vacations for Web Design and Social Media Graphics

Digital platforms present unique challenges for script fonts due to varying screen resolutions and aspect ratios. Vacations holds up well in web design, particularly in hero sections where large text sizes are common. Its refined curves render sharply on high-DPI displays, maintaining the elegance intended by the typeface designer. I placed this font in a website header for a photography portfolio, and it added a sophisticated editorial feel that complemented the visual content perfectly.

For social media content creators and marketers, consistency is key. Using Vacations across Instagram posts, Pinterest pins, and Facebook covers creates a recognizable visual thread. Because it is a premium font with a distinct style, it helps brands establish a unique voice. However, always ensure that the text size is large enough to be readable on smaller screens. Avoid using it for dense blocks of text or long blog posts; instead, reserve it for pull quotes, section headers, and call-to-action buttons where its elegance can shine without overwhelming the reader.

Font Pairing and Practical Usage Tips

To get the most out of Vacations, understanding how to pair it with other typefaces is essential. As mentioned, it pairs exceptionally well with modern typography systems that include clean sans serifs or classic serifs. For example, combining Vacations with a geometric sans serif creates a contemporary, trendy look suitable for fashion or lifestyle brands. Pairing it with a traditional serif font can evoke a sense of heritage and trust, ideal for law firms or established businesses wanting a creative twist.

Before incorporating this font into final client work, take time to test it in various contexts. Check how it looks in black and white, as color can sometimes mask poor spacing or alignment issues. Review the included styles and weights if available, and experiment with the ligatures and swashes to find the right level of decoration for your project. Remember to check commercial font licensing carefully. If you plan to use Vacations in templates, merchandise, or digital products for resale, ensure your license permits such use to avoid legal complications.
